Dinamo Zagreb's dominance leaves Croatian league without strong competition, says Miguel Olmo
Miguel Olmo, father of Spanish World Cup winner Dani Olmo, told Sportske novosti that Dinamo Zagreb was crucial in his son's development. He said the club gave Dani the platform to become a Barcelona and Spain star and praised Dinamo’s competitive spirit, noting that "Dinamo je najveći hrvatski klub, on je za mog sina sve!".
Olmo also criticised the Croatian league, arguing that other clubs cannot adequately challenge Dinamo’s dominance. He said the league "nedostaje nekoliko stvari, nijansi i detalja da sve bude još bolje, makar je i ovako Hrvatska među najboljima" and warned that greater competition would improve the quality and development of Croatian football.
